Lets compare vitamin content per 300 calories of Boiled Carrots vs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P:
300 calories of Boiled Carrots have 1380.6 times more Vitamin A, 408.3 times more Vitamin C, 18.5 times more Vitamin E and 259 times more Vitamin K than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P.
While 300 kcal of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P contain 2.1 times more Vitamin B1, 3.6 times more Vitamin B2, 2.8 times more Vitamin B3 and 10.3 times more Vitamin B9 than Boiled and Drained Carrots.
Both Boiled Carrots and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P provide similar amounts of Vitamin B6 per 300 calories.
300 calories of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in C, Vitamin E and Vitamin K
Both Boiled and Drained Carrots as well as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 300 calories.
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Boiled Carrots vs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P:
300 calories of Boiled Carrots have 30.9 times more Calcium, 1.6 times more Copper, 2.1 times more Magnesium, 2 times more Phosphorus, 14.3 times more Potassium and 409.1 times more Water than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P.
While 300 kcal of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P contain 5.1 times more Iron, 1.3 times more Selenium and 6.9 times more Zinc than Boiled and Drained Carrots.
Both Boiled Carrots and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P contain similar levels of Sodium per 300 calories.
300 calories of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P lack sufficient amounts of Calcium and Potassium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Boiled Carrots have 13.1 times more Fiber and 1.9 times more Protein than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P.
While 300 kcal of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P contain 9.1 times more Saturated Fat than Boiled and Drained Carrots.
Both Boiled Carrots and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P offer comparable quantities of Energy, Carbohydrate and Sugars per 300 calories.
300 calories of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P provide inadequate amounts of Fiber
Both Boiled and Drained Carrots as well as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, CAP prov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 and Omega 6 in 300 calories.
